NJ Mirror & Glass destroyed in Kenilworth three-alarm fire

KENILWORTH – A local business, NJ Mirror & Glass, has been destroyed in a three-alarm fire early Saturday morning.

Around 3:26 a.m. Oct. 7, Township firefighters responded to NJ Mirror & Glass on Kenilworth Boulevard on reports of a structure fire. Upon arrival, firefighters reported visible smoke and fire on the exterior of the store, authorities said.

Firefighters fought the fire and put it out in three hours.

Firefighters from Union, Cranford, Roselle Park, Scotch Plains, Springfield, and Garwood fire departments responded to fight the blaze, authorities said.

The cause of the fire is currently under investigation.
